Good to know

Drying alcoholnote

A lightweight, volatile alcohol that can feel drying for some — different from the nourishing fatty alcohols.

What it does

moderate evidence

" It is a versatile, fast-evaporating solvent with bactericidal and antifungal action, used to dissolve actives and fragrances, extract botanicals, give products a light quick-drying feel, and disinfect. It is a formulation and processing aid rather than a skin-care benefit ingredient.

Benefits

  • Broad solvent power that dissolves many ingredients water and oil cannot, useful for thin, elegant formulas
  • Antiseptic and antimicrobial, with bactericidal and antifungal effects (the basis of hand sanitizers and medical wipes)
  • Evaporates fast and is easy to remove, making it a popular extracting agent for botanicals
  • Acts as an astringent and penetration enhancer in toners and lightweight products

Side effects

  • Pure ethanol will irritate the skin and eyes
  • Drying and dehydrating in high amounts or with frequent leave-on use
  • May sting or aggravate sensitive, broken, or barrier-compromised skin

Who it's for

Oily or combination skin comfortable with a fast-drying feel, and formulas needing a solvent, extractant, or antimicrobial carrier

Who should be careful

Dry, sensitive, or compromised skin should limit high-concentration leave-on exposure; keep away from broken skin and eyes
